Reality and illusion go out for a night on the town and wake up in someone else's bed with hangovers and no idea what they got up to in this surreal series from the Mind of Tim. There is an old man who seems to know what is going one, a boy and a girl lost in a desert without food and water, and a young man who isn't sure where his dreams start and his life ends.

While it has a strong dose of Matrix inspired concern with the power of the mind, Tim's story is genuinely intriguing. Just how many bizarre transformations and symbolist experiences can the young hero take before he gives up trying to figure out just what is going on here?

Tim does a good job with the artwork, handling the various environments and characters with confidence.

In a Word: Hallucinatory.
